As the extended Gaza ceasefire enters its final days, regional powers and the United States are consulting on extending the pause in the Israel-Hamas war.
According to international media reports, “During talks in Doha, Qatar on Tuesday, officials representing Israel, the United States, Qatar and Egypt agreed to work on extending the current ceasefire in the Israel-Hamas war to evacuate more hostages from Gaza. “
The expectation is that if all goes well on Wednesday’s sixth day of the truce — and Hamas releases at least 10 Israeli hostages as planned — Hamas could draw up an additional list of hostages for the next day, extending the break another 24 hours, the report said.
According to the report, “Negotiators believe there are enough women and children in Hamas captivity to extend the ceasefire for two more days before talks begin to release men and soldiers hostage.”
On Tuesday, thirty Palestinian women and children were released from Israeli prisons after 10 Israelis and two foreign nationals were freed from Gaza.
Palestinians in Gaza hope the Israel-Hamas ceasefire will be extended as they seek much-needed aid as they assess the destruction from Israeli bombing.
